Azerbaijan Intellectuals Party makes first appointments

Baku. Elnur Mammadli –APA. Azerbaijani Intellectual Party’s Supreme Majlis (Council) held its first meeting after the party’s constituent congress and established its governing institutions. Former member of the parliament Nizami Guliyev was elected as a chairman of the party’s Supreme Majlis, APA reports. Gorkhmaz Ibrahimli became the first deputy chairman, Gadir Ibrahimli - the deputy chairman on economic issues, Khanoglan Ahmadov – on organizational issues, Fuad Mammadov – on political issues and Afgan Asadov – the deputy chairman of Supreme Majlis.
The Majlis established nine-member Political Council of the party as well.
